Feature | Fujifilm X T20 | Canon EOS 650D + Canon EF-S 18-55mm |
---|---|---|
Resolution | 24.3 MP | 18 MP |
Sensor Type | X-Trans CMOS III | CMOS |
ISO Range | 200-12800 (expandable to 100-51200) | 100-12800 (expandable to 25600) |
Image Stabilization | No | No |
Auto Focus Points | 91 | 9 |
Continuous Shooting Speed | Up to 14 fps | Up to 5 fps |
Video Recording | 4K at 30 fps | 1080p at 30 fps |
Viewfinder Type | Electronic | Optical |
Screen Size | 3.0 inches | 3.0 inches |
Screen Resolution | 1040k dots | 1040k dots |
Wireless Connectivity | Yes | Yes |
Battery Life | Up to 350 shots | Up to 440 shots |
Weight | Approx. 383g (including battery and memory card) | Approx. 575g (including battery and memory card) |
Dimensions | 118.4 x 82.8 x 41.4 mm | 133.1 x 99.8 x 78.8 mm |
